Obstruction of gastric emptying secondary to atrium pancreatic heterotopia

Avilés-Salas A, Castro-Ortega CB

ABSTRACT

Heterotopic pancreas (HP) is a relatively infrequent lesion most often found in the stomach. In the majority of cases, HP does not cause symptoms, but it can occasionally present as dyspepsia and upper gastrointestinal bleeding. This report describes the case of a 40-year-old man with gastric outlet obstruction resulting from HP in gastric antrum.
